Christie + Co sells former Stop Inn in Hull

9th November 2009, 10:44am

Acting on behalf of EjendomsInvest, the private Danish fund, Christie + Co has sold the freehold interest of the former Stop Inn Hull in East Riding of Yorkshire.

The hotel was sold to a private, Manchester-based property investor, for an undisclosed sum.

The 59-bedroom hotel, which was formerly operated by the Real Hotel Company, is located in Hull city centre near the main line train station and features two function rooms with capacity for 140, the Strudles restaurant, a bar, and car parking.

The new owner plans to refurbish the hotel, which is currently closed, and re-open the business in the New Year.

The disposal of the ex-Real Hotel Company site, follows the sale of the former 73-bedroom Stop Inn Southcrest Hotel in Redditch, Worcestershire, for an undisclosed sum, through Christie + Co at the end of August.

The 55-bedroom former Stop Inn Skelmersdale in Lancashire, which is also on the market with Christie + Co, is currently under offer, with a sale expected before the end of the year.

Sebastian Meredith, Associate Director at Christie + Co, said: "The hotel generated a lot of interest while on the market and a number of offers were received. This central-located property offers the perfect opportunity for rebranding and repositioning."
